.calendar-page_calendar-page-hero__VT6Tx{color:var(--theme-color-darkest-foreground);background-color:var(--theme-color-darkest-background)}.calendar-page_calendar-page-hero__content__shwi_{display:flex;flex-direction:column;align-items:center;justify-content:center;padding-top:var(--spacing-16);padding-bottom:var(--spacing-6);text-align:center}.calendar-page_calendar-page-hero__content__shwi_ hr{width:100%;margin:var(--spacing-6) 0}.calendar-page_calendar-page-hero__content__shwi_>.headline,.calendar-page_calendar-page-hero__content__shwi_>h2{color:var(--theme-color-darkest-foreground)}.calendar-page_whats-on-mode___EDh7{display:flex;flex-direction:column;align-items:center;width:100%;max-width:800px;margin-top:var(--spacing-4);margin-bottom:var(--spacing-4)}.calendar-page_whats-on-mode__heading__rGXWJ{color:var(--color-white)}.calendar-page_whats-on-mode__selector__hizMw{display:flex}.calendar-page_whats-on-mode__selector-button__XjFFo{padding:var(--spacing-3) var(--spacing-4);color:var(--color-white);text-transform:uppercase;background-color:var(--theme-color-darkest-background);border-right:2px solid var(--color-white);border:2px solid var(--color-white);border-right-width:1px;border-top-left-radius:30px;border-bottom-left-radius:30px}.calendar-page_whats-on-mode__selector-button__XjFFo:nth-child(2){border-right:2px solid var(--color-white);border-left:1px solid var(--color-white);border-radius:0 30px 30px 0}.calendar-page_whats-on-mode__selector-button__XjFFo:hover{color:var(--theme-color-darkest-background);background-color:var(--color-white)}.calendar-page_whats-on-mode__selector-button__XjFFo:focus-visible{color:var(--theme-color-darkest-background);background-color:var(--theme-color-darkest-foreground);border-color:var(--theme-color-darkest-background);outline:var(--spacing-1) solid var(--theme-color-darkest-foreground);outline-offset:2px}.calendar-page_whats-on-mode__selector-button--active__Wne6E{color:var(--theme-color-darkest-background);background-color:var(--color-white)}.calendar-page_date-option-active__JvfjL,.calendar-page_date-option__jmYrL{flex:1;padding:var(--spacing-3) var(--spacing-4);font-size:var(--font-size-md);letter-spacing:.5px;cursor:pointer;background-color:var(--color-white);border:none;transition:background-color .3s}.calendar-page_date-option__jmYrL{flex-shrink:0;width:-moz-fit-content;width:fit-content;color:var(--color-white);text-transform:uppercase;text-wrap:nowrap;background-color:var(--theme-color-darkest-background)}.calendar-page_date-option-active__JvfjL{color:var(--theme-color-darkest-background);background-color:var(--color-white)}@keyframes calendar-page_controls-in__V2S3z{0%{max-height:0;opacity:0;transform:translateY(-10px)}to{max-height:500px;opacity:1;transform:translateY(0)}}@keyframes calendar-page_controls-out__4g2nH{0%{max-height:500px;opacity:1;transform:translateY(0)}to{max-height:0;opacity:0;transform:translateY(-10px)}}@media (prefers-reduced-motion:no-preference){.calendar-page_date-range-picker--in__tk1rp{animation:calendar-page_controls-in__V2S3z .7s cubic-bezier(.25,1,.5,1);animation-fill-mode:both}.calendar-page_date-range-picker--out__C_sM6{animation:calendar-page_controls-out__4g2nH .5s cubic-bezier(.25,1,.5,1);animation-fill-mode:both}}.calendar-page_date-range-picker__AL7Ab{display:flex;flex-direction:column;align-items:center;justify-content:center}.calendar-page_date-range-picker--active___k_te{animation-direction:normal}.calendar-page_date-range-picker-form-container__kewyY{display:flex;justify-content:center;width:100%;padding:var(--spacing-4)}.calendar-page_date-range-picker-form-divider__WrtM_{margin:var(--spacing-4) 0 0 0}@media (prefers-reduced-motion:no-preference){.calendar-page_date-range-picker-form-divider__WrtM_{animation:calendar-page_controls-in__V2S3z .5s cubic-bezier(.25,1,.5,1);animation-fill-mode:both}}.calendar-page_current-refinements-container__sUdRR{display:flex;justify-content:center;width:100%}.calendar-page_current-refinements-container__current-refinements__yvmA9{margin-top:var(--spacing-8)}@media screen and (width < 768px){.calendar-page_current-refinements-container__current-refinements__yvmA9{margin-top:var(--spacing-4)}}@media (prefers-reduced-motion:no-preference){.calendar-page_current-refinements-container__current-refinements__yvmA9{animation:calendar-page_controls-in__V2S3z .5s cubic-bezier(.25,1,.5,1);animation-fill-mode:both}}.calendar-page_results-container__AD_R0{padding:var(--spacing-10) 0 0 0}@media screen and (width <= 768px){.calendar-page_results-container__AD_R0{padding:var(--spacing-4) 0 0 0}}.calendar-page_results-container__grid__NMF_F{display:grid;grid-template-columns:1fr 5fr;gap:var(--spacing-6)}@media screen and (width <= 768px){.calendar-page_results-container__grid__NMF_F{grid-template-columns:1fr}}@media screen and (width >= 1440px){.calendar-page_results-container__grid__NMF_F{gap:var(--spacing-8)}}.calendar-page_results-container__sidebar__ue9LF{grid-column:1/span 1}@media (width <= 768px){.calendar-page_results-container__sidebar__ue9LF{display:none}}.calendar-page_results-container__main__kVV_o{grid-column:2/span 1;scroll-margin-top:100px}@media screen and (width <= 768px){.calendar-page_results-container__main__kVV_o{grid-column:1/span 1}}.calendar-page_results-container__title__77Bel{margin-bottom:var(--spacing-4)}.calendar-page_results-container__hits-count__ULOa5{margin-bottom:var(--spacing-8)}.calendar-page_results-container__filters-button-container__U_pL_{display:flex;flex-direction:column;align-items:center;justify-content:center;margin-bottom:var(--spacing-10)}@media screen and (width >= 768px){.calendar-page_results-container__filters-button-container__U_pL_{display:none}}